Duties

Reporting to the Head Coach of Women’s Basketball, the Director of Basketball Ops will support the Women’s Basketball program by performing the following duties:

  • Is responsible for game day and practice management before, during, and after competition for all home and away games.
  • Manages all team travel logistics.
  • Works with Head Coach to manages the budget for the program, including collaborating with the Finance team to forecast quarterly. Tracks all expenses.
  • Oversees student managers’ day-to-day operations, including all games and practices.
  • Assists with video and film exchange to assist coaches in team preparation.
  • Oversees planning, purchasing, branding, and distribution of apparel, equipment, and gear for team, coaches, and travel party. Manages equipment budget.
  • Coordinates with sports marketing staff to market and promote the Women’s Basketball Program.
  • Assists in managing social networks (i.e. Facebook and Twitter).
  • Assists with all camps, clinics, and community service initiatives.
  • Assists with on campus housing for student-athletes.
  • Manages the administrative function for the Women’s Basketball Program.

The position is based at GW’s Foggy Bottom Campus in Washington, DC but will require significant domestic travel for games and events. The incumbent may perform other related duties as assigned.
